The Role Want to work on building out security from the ground up at the leading edge of AI in healthcare globally? We’re looking for a very experienced and highly motivated Senior or Staff Security Infrastructure Engineer to join our team as one of the first engineers on the Abridge Security team. In this role, you’ll be a key technical leader, driving key initiatives that shape our product, infrastructure, and engineering practices. You’ll work cross‑functionally with product and engineering teams to integrate security seamlessly, automate security capabilities and controls, design and implement the high‑scale infrastructure and data pipelines that power our security organization, and mentor others to build secure‑by‑default systems at scale in the age of AI. This position requires deep technical expertise, a builder’s mindset, and excellent communication skills to influence security culture across the organization. This is a greenfield opportunity to architect the way forward for security at Abridge. You will thrive here if you are passionate about building 0 → 1 and believe that modern security is, at its core, a large‑scale data and automation challenge. What You’ll Do Build the Security Data Backbone: Design, build, and operate high‑scale data pipelines to ingest, normalize, and enrich security telemetry for our detection and response functions. Engineer Internal Security Platforms: Develop and maintain self‑service platforms that allow security teams to manage secrets, identity perimeters, and security guardrails at scale. Automation and DevSecOps: Write production‑grade services to automate complex security workflows, turning manual interventions into reliable, code‑driven processes. Infrastructure‑as‑Code (IaC): Establish automated security guardrails and golden path modules that ensure our cloud resources are secure by default. Codify infrastructure including networking, IAM, Kubernetes, databases, streaming and pubsub platforms, storage, distribution, and more. Enable Cross‑Functional Teams: Partner with platform and product engineering to integrate security requirements into the developer lifecycle without introducing friction. Greenfield Leadership: Influence the selection of our security stack, evaluating build vs. buy for core security tooling, and establishing the engineering standards for a growing team. What You’ll Bring Engineering Maturity: 8+ years of software engineering experience, including 5+ years of infrastructure‑as‑code experience in a cloud‑first organization. You bring the seasoned perspective required to establish infrastructure standards for a founding team. The “Platform First” Mindset: You are a software or systems engineer who has spent years building in cloud‑native environments (GCP or AWS). You view security as a platform service, not a gate, and have a track record of building tools that people actually enjoy using. Systems Architecture: Experience designing for high availability and scale. You understand how to handle “bursty” security log traffic and build resilient, distributed systems. Experience building and maintaining data pipelines is a plus. Software Engineering: Expert proficiency in at least one modern general‑purpose language (Python is a plus). You write clean, testable, and maintainable code. Cross‑Functional Influence: Demonstrated ability to drive large, cross‑functional technical projects that impact security posture across the entire organization. Pragmatic Execution: You have a bias for action and a knack for navigating ambiguity. You understand how to weigh security risks against business velocity, choosing paved road solutions that empower your internal partners and developers.
